(Metropolitan Washington Council, AFL-CIO)Mark your calendar now for two big don’t-miss
actions coming up in the local labor scene. On
Martin Luther King Jr. Day (this coming
Monday) the Maryland State and District
of Columbia AFL-CIO is planning a Rally
for Jobs, Justice and Equality on Lawyers
Mall in Annapolis, MD. Then, in early February,
the Conservative Political Action Conference
(CPAC) is coming to DC featuring Wisconsin
Governor Scott Walker as a keynote speaker.
“Last year we made sure workers voices were
heard against Governor Walker’s anti-worker
legislation” said Metro Council President Jos
Williams. “This February we’re going to
show him the District continues to defend
workers’ rights and that his anti-worker
legislation is not welcome here.” CPAC is
happening from February 9 to 11. Stay tuned for
